Santa Fe

Santa Fe is a small firepot of cultural activity.On a bi-anual basis, the National University Universidad Nacional del Litoral hosts a week long music and arts festival wich is very well known and appreciated among the youth. Other week-long events are hosted around the year, specially in theater, poetry, dances and choirs. It's really astonishing the amount of cultural events happening on a daily basis for such a small town.The local rock music scene is quite restless also, despite the scarsity of stages. It is also very rich as it spans almost any sub-genre of the rock music, from completely ethnical or Folclore-like rock music to heavy and even trendy or experimental.Other genres of music are of course to be found and "peñas folkclóricas" are a must if you come across one. They are basically one of the truest form of local culture: "empanadas" and wine, music Zambas, Chacareras, Gatos, Cielitos, Pericón, etc. and dancing.Standar package of museums is to be found as in any major city: Rosa Galisteo, Etnográfico are the 2 biggest, both in the southern area.
